The Class of '72 has elected its officers for the '68‑'69 school year. Chosen were Ken Steinken, president; Jeff Hoke, vice-president; Kathleen Jordan, secretary; and JoDee Rowells, treasurer.
During the first few weeks of school, the students who were interested in becoming an officer were asked to obtain a petition from the Personnel Office. They were then required to get the signatures of 30 members of the Freshman Class. The candidates were then voted for in the homerooms.
The first class council meeting was held on Thursday, September 19. Plans for the homecoming float were discussed at this meeting. A second meeting was called for Tuesday, Sept. 24, at which homecoming plans were decided upon.
The freshman Student Council members have also been chosen. After filing a petition containing the signatures of 25 members of the Freshman Class, any student was eligible to run. Voting was held in the homerooms. In all, 18 students were selected.
Chosen were Tom Hanna, David Johnson, Kurt Klein, John Leer, Ed Mueller, Kenneth Piest, John Richards, Gary Williams, and John Fisher.
Also included are Carol Gigante, Joy Gunderson, Jennifer Jobst, Kathleen Jordan, Merry Kelly, Diana Lambert, Maura Neff, JoLynn Scheunuman, and Beth Shakespeare.
This year's Freshman Class sponsors are Mr. Harvey Kelber and Miss Diane Schlieckert.
